What is a luggage tag on a cruise?

My Celebrity cruise leaves the 15th of Feb. I’ve heard that they send you luggage tags? What are these? How soon should I get them?

    Luggage tags for a cruise line are very important because they are just like the airline luggage tags; they direct you luggage to your cabin.

    When you get to the pier to board the ship you will hand over your luggage to a porter who will take it to the place where it is scanned, same as at the airport, and then loaded on the ship. Then the ship’s personnel use the luggage tags to tell them where your luggage should go, what cabin. You will take your carry-on bags on ship yourself and they will also go through a scanner just like the belt at the airport and then you carry them on. So the luggage tags are absolutely necessary for you to get your luggage.

    You should receive your cruise documents about 15 to 30 days before your cruise and the information you receive will have luggage tags. In most cases the tags will have your name printed on them and for sure your cabin number and the date of your sailing. You will receive a maximum of three luggage tags per person in your cabin. Since I usually have no more than two pieces of checked luggage I always put the other tag on my carryon so that if I set it down somewhere and forget it it will have a tag on it.

    When you are ready to get off the ship at the end of the cruise you will receive a different set of luggage tags the day before your cruise ends. These will be color coded and are used to determine the order that you exit the ship. Those with the earliest flight and/or who use the “express departure” will go first.     Your cruise luggage tag will have your cabin number and deck level (sometimes your name too).
    When you board the ship, your large bags will checked with the porter, and they will use the luggage tags to identify your cabin and deliver your luggage.
    your travel may provide the tags, or the porter at the luggage check in will give you a tag.

    Luggage tags are tags that you put on each piece of luggage. They have the name of the ship and your stateroom number. There’s usually a different color for each deck. The tag tells the porter where to take your luggage.
    You will board the ship with only your carry ons. Your luggage will take up to a few hours to get to your stateroom. Dorothy C

    All cruise lines used to send very nice luggage tags. More and more, they are not sending anything, but asking you to download them. It is really nothing to worry about, because if you don’t get them in advance, they will have plenty at the pier. sally b

    You can print them off the computer. The cruise lines website will have all your info. you will just have to set up a log in. Then print out your tags for ALL your luggage pieces. My last cruise I didn’t put the tags on until I got to the pier. I was flying there and did not want them ripped. I brought some tape with me and taped them on. Kim
